Associations and political participation of people with disabilities
the case of associations participating in the German disability council

The study presents data on political participation activities carried out between 2014 and 2023 by associations that are part of the German Disability Council. The text begins with a literature review on barriers to the political participation of persons with disabilities, followed by a brief history of this type of association in Germany. The data was mapped by analyzing the associations' statutes, websites, and official social media pages. The main objectives of the associations are to represent the interests of persons with disabilities and rare/chronic diseases; improve the quality of life and the dissemination of information, production of knowledge, and support for research and science. There is significant political participation, with presence in central deliberation spaces in the formulation of disability policies, working in networks, and monitoring the implementation of the Convention on the Rights of Persons with Disabilities in Germany.
